#189294 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#189294 is composed of 9.4% red, 57.3%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.8% cyan, 1.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 181 degrees, a saturation of 72.1% and a lightness of 33.7%. #189294 color hex could be obtained by blending #30ffff with #002529.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

Shades and Tints of #189294
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020d0d is the darkest color, while #fbf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#189294
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#545858 is the less saturated color, while #04a5a8 is the most saturated one.
